50 reservists from 201 Field Hospital are doing a 3 month tour in Afghanistan, where theyll work at the Camp Bastion Hospital saving the lives and limbs of injured soldiers. The unit consists of a Regimental Headquarters (RHQ) in Newcastle-Upon-Tyne, A Detachment at Newton Aycliffe, B Detachment at Newcastle-Upon-Tyne and C Detachment at Norton near Stockton-On-Tees.

Fifty TA medics from 201 Field Hospital are on their way to a three month deployment to Afghanistan where they'll use their life saving expertise in the cutting edge military hospital in Camp Bastion.

After a year and a half's training, they spent a week completing an intense, real-time and realistic emergency exercise.... and we haEXCLUSIVE access to see just how real it was:

A detailed mock-up of Camp Bastion’s Hospital was created to prepare the medical staff for the clinical pressures they will face in theatre.

The medics were joined by a team of amputee actors and veterans, who usetheir personal trauma experiences and realistic make-up and prosthetics to simulate the kind of injuries that might happen on tour...They remainein character throughout a scenario to ensure the training experience iwas intense and realistic, helping improve performance in the treatment of catastrophic battle field injuries.
